Annotated Snippet
#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ause)
%YAML 1.2
---
$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/mailbox/riscv,sbi-mpxy-mbox.yaml#
$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
title: RISC-V SBI Message Proxy (MPXY) extension based mailbox
maintainers:
- Anup Patel <anup@brainfault.org>
description: |
The RISC-V SBI Message Proxy (MPXY) extension [1] allows supervisor
software to send messages through the SBI implementation (M-mode
firmware or HS-mode hypervisor). The underlying message protocol
and message format used by the supervisor software could be some
other standard protocol compatible with the SBI MPXY extension
(such as RISC-V Platform Management Interface (RPMI) [2]).
===========================================
References
===========================================
[1] RISC-V Supervisor Binary Interface (SBI) v3.0 (or higher)
https://github.com/riscv-non-isa/riscv-sbi-doc/releases
[2] RISC-V Platform Management Interface (RPMI) v1.0 (or higher)
https://github.com/riscv-non-isa/riscv-rpmi/releases
properties:
compatible:
const: riscv,sbi-mpxy-mbox
"#mbox-cells":
const: 2
description:
The first cell specifies channel_id of the SBI MPXY channel,
the second cell specifies MSG_PROT_ID of the SBI MPXY channel
required:
- compatible
- "#mbox-cells"
additionalProperties: false
examples:
- |
mailbox {
compatible = "riscv,sbi-mpxy-mbox";
#mbox-cells = <2>;
};
